About the role

As a Moorepay Product Manager you will lead the creation and execution of the roadmap of your product with passion and ownership to deliver success for your customers. You will balance the strategic roadmap with demands of legislation, innovation, customer requirements and technical focus to deliver amazing user experiences and delighted customers.

You will be curious, proactive and passionate using a data-led approach to customer-centric roadmaps. You will gain deep insights into customer pain points and challenges, informing every step of your product evolution, translating this to the ‘what’ and ‘why’ of your products’ existence.

You will think beyond the functions and features of your product, working with the wider portfolio to deliver a whole experience that not only solves your customers’ challenges but exceeds their expectations, owning and driving the commercial success as a result.

 Key Responsibilities

  • Engage directly with your existing and potential customers to develop a deep and empathetic understanding of their needs, pains, challenges and their own strategy.
  • Collaborate closely with the Principal Product Manager for your product line and with senior business stakeholders to understand the vision and high-level product strategy which act as anchors for your roadmap and prioritisation.
  • Create, maintain and communicate a product roadmap which delivers defined themed strategic goals and moves the product towards the vision.
  • Seek out, gather and track commercial, user and sentiment metrics about your product as well as identification of key risks.Determine the prioritisation of activities in your roadmap which will positively impact these metrics, confirmed through your tracking.
  • Gain a clear understanding of your competitors.
  • Understand the commercial and business value of your roadmap items and adapt your prioritisation accordingly.
  • Collaborate with your Engineering teams to develop best-practice solutions that satisfy your roadmap needs whilst allowing for close attention to architecture, security, scalability and code quality, as well as nurturing innovation and ideas.
  • Support GTM activities, before during and after development, communicating the value and benefits to customers and internal business stakeholders.
